			Took out my Browing 2000 yesterday useing the 2.75 in. barrel.  I have True Lock thin wall chokes installed in that barrel and installed an extra full flush choke.  Tried a no. of lead loads, Kent and Win. 4, 5, and 6s.  Both brands threw excellent patterns with 5s.  Then went to Heavy Shot Classic Doubles in case I want to hunt a Fed. WPA.  Tried both 4s and 5s, each did well, but surprizingly the 4s were better in that particular gun.  Have 2 dedicated turkey guns, that'll stay home this year, decided to try the 2000.
